How to prepare for a job interview at Coburg Banks Limited

Know Your Market

Before the interview, do your homework on the education sector, especially regarding schools and academy trusts. Understand current trends and challenges they face, so you can discuss how your skills can help address these issues.

Showcase Your Relationship-Building Skills

As a New Business Development Manager, building relationships is key. Prepare examples of how you've successfully developed partnerships in the past. Be ready to discuss your approach to networking and maintaining long-term client relationships.

Prepare for Scenario Questions

Expect scenario-based questions that assess your problem-solving abilities. Think about potential challenges you might face in this role and how you would tackle them. Practising your responses will help you feel more confident during the interview.

Highlight Your Sales Achievements

Be prepared to discuss your previous sales successes and how you achieved them. Use specific metrics to demonstrate your impact, such as percentage growth in sales or number of new clients acquired. This will show your potential employer that you can deliver results.
